A new report from Stephen Moses, president of the Center for Long-Term Care Reform, contends that “although Medicaid was intended to serve only the truly needy, eligibility expansions and loopholes have turned the program into a middle-class entitlement.” That means fewer resources are available for the safety net Medicaid was intended to provide for low-income retirees.
